Transaction 2edb87d61fcb1a5b19a4580e19d426df0aa5e62074060a59d067a9b9a17d642c
1 Input
1 Output
-
2edb87d61fcb1a5b19a4580e19d426df0aa5e62074060a59d067a9b9a17d642c:0
- value
- 24953515
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3421c9a28f017f380a9e3c942d859b687f93175
- address
- bc1qudppex3g7qtl8q9fu0y59kzek6rljvt4xas885